# §2016.5. Information exempt from public inspection.

- (a) Information submitted in confidence shall be exempt from public inspection if USTR determines that the disclosure of such information is not required by law.
- (b) A person requesting an exemption from public inspection for information submitted in writing shall clearly mark each page “BUSINESS CONFIDENTIAL” at the top, and shall submit a non-confidential summary of the confidential information. Such person shall also provide a written explanation of why the material should be so protected.
- (c) A request for exemption of any particular information may be denied if USTR determines that such information is not entitled to exemption under law. In the event of such a denial, the information will be returned to the person who submitted it, with a statement of the reasons for the denial.
